#7cc919 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7cc919 is composed of 48.6% red, 78.8%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.6%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 86.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 44.3%. #7cc919 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ff32 with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#7cc919

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060901 is the darkest color, while #fbfef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cc919

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717270 is the less saturated color, while #7eda08 is the most saturated one.
